All posts

Logs Access Proxy Observability-Driven Debugging

Debugging complex systems requires more than just logs. Even though logs capture a lot of crucial information, they often lack full context and can leave engineers guessing. Observability-driven debugging helps bridge this gap by offering insights that are both efficient and actionable. A logs access proxy enables you to layer observability into your debugging processes without overhauling your infrastructure. Let's break down what this means, why it's essential, and how it can simplify debuggi

Free White Paper

Database Access Proxy + AI Observability: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Debugging complex systems requires more than just logs. Even though logs capture a lot of crucial information, they often lack full context and can leave engineers guessing. Observability-driven debugging helps bridge this gap by offering insights that are both efficient and actionable. A logs access proxy enables you to layer observability into your debugging processes without overhauling your infrastructure.

Let's break down what this means, why it's essential, and how it can simplify debugging for distributed systems.


What is Observability-Driven Debugging?

Observability-driven debugging is a method that uses observable data to accelerate root-cause analysis and issue resolution. Traditional debugging often starts with logs, metrics, or traces—but observability combines these into a more holistic view. This approach prioritizes system transparency so that engineers can detect abnormalities, track system behavior, and pinpoint problems.

Logs are an important part of observability, but they’re often scattered and hard to correlate in distributed systems. Observability-driven debugging makes these connections for you, turning raw data into actionable intelligence.


Why Use a Logs Access Proxy?

A logs access proxy acts as an intermediary between log-producing systems and destinations like log analyzers or observability platforms. Its primary role is to standardize, enrich, and route log data efficiently.

Continue reading? Get the full guide.

Database Access Proxy + AI Observability: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Here’s why this is valuable:

  1. Centralized Data Collection
    Instead of parsing through logs in multiple systems, a proxy lets you gather them in one place. This improves your point of control and simplifies log access.
  2. Real-Time Enrichment
    Enrich logs with metadata, correlation IDs, or other relevant information. This ensures your debugging team has all the context they need when an incident occurs.
  3. Filtering and Routing
    A logs access proxy provides fine-grained control by filtering unwanted logs and routing only the relevant ones. This improves processing speeds and reduces the storage costs that bloated log collections create.
  4. Integration with Observability Platforms
    Seamlessly feed logs into broader observability pipelines for unified analysis alongside metrics and traces.

Debugging with a Logs Access Proxy

Debugging becomes more systematic when you utilize a logs access proxy alongside observability. Here’s how it looks from a practical standpoint:

  1. Quick Contextualization
    When an issue arises, enriched logs routed through the proxy already contain critical details like timestamps, session IDs, or application versions. Engineers investigate with less back-and-forth.
  2. Improved Signal-to-Noise Ratio
    By filtering unnecessary logs at the proxy level, you eliminate distractions. This ensures that teams focus solely on relevant data.
  3. Rapid Root Cause Analysis
    Observability is about connecting dots. Streams of logs provided through the proxy, in combination with traces and metrics, make these connections quick and intuitive.
  4. Scales with System Complexity
    Whether your stack has 5 services or 500 microservices, the proxy's routing and filtering capabilities scale to keep observability actionable.

Benefits That Drive Results

Using a logs access proxy bolsters your observability efforts and directly impacts your debugging efficiency. You’ll save time, eliminate redundant steps, and empower engineers to solve issues consistently, even in high-pressure scenarios. For managers, it means fewer outages and more reliable systems.


Start Observability-Driven Debugging in Minutes

Deploying observability doesn’t have to be a bottleneck, and you don’t need weeks to test it. With hoop.dev, you can see the impact of observability-driven debugging with a fully integrated logs access proxy in just minutes. Experience for yourself how enriched, centralized log access speeds up your debugging process without overwhelming your team.

Start now and streamline your debugging workflows with observability.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ts